Meme coins are all on alert! DOGE, SHIB, and PEPE are showing sell signals, raising fears of a new round of fall.

As the overall selling pressure in the crypto assets market intensifies, the three major popular meme coins — DOGE, SHIB, and PEPE — are all showing technical sell signals. Signals such as MACD cross below, RSI declining, and pattern breakdown indicate that market sentiment is rapidly shifting towards bearish, with significant short-term downside risk increasing.

Overall Market Sentiment: Bears Dominate

According to CoinGlass data, the short positions in the derivatives market for DOGE, SHIB, and PEPE continue to rise:

DOGE: The short selling ratio in the past 24 hours is 55%.

SHIB: The short position accounts for 57%

This indicates that risk aversion is spreading, with most traders expecting prices to decline further.

DOGE: MACD issues a sell signal

Current price: Approaching the 50-day EMA ($0.2163)

Technical Analysis:

MACD crosses below the signal line → sell signal

RSI: 47, broke below the midline, buying momentum weakened

Downward target: If it breaks below the 50-day EMA, or tests the 200-day EMA ($0.2100)

Bounce conditions: Hold support and bounce, may retest the resistance at $0.2407

Shiba Inu (SHIB): Triangle formation is on the verge of collapse

Current price: Approaching the lower support of the symmetrical triangle (0.00001244 USD)

Technical Analysis:

MACD and the signal line issue a sell signal

RSI: 43, indicating that buying pressure continues to decline.

Downward target: If it breaks the support, it may test 0.00001166 USD.

Bounce conditions: Bounce within the triangle, or retest the 50-day EMA ($0.00001304)

PEPE coin (PEPE): Death Cross Risk Approaches

Current price: close to psychological support 0.00001000 USD

Technical Analysis:

The MACD has continued to decline since the crossover on Saturday.

RSI: 42, momentum is bearish

The 50-day and 200-day EMA are rapidly approaching, which may form a "death cross."

Downward target: Breaking below psychological support will test 0.00000986 USD

Bounce conditions: Recovery of the 200-day EMA ($0.00001120) can restart the bullish trend.

Conclusion

DOGE, SHIB, and PEPE are currently showing a consistent downward trend in technical analysis, with MACD sell signals and declining RSI indicating that short-term dumping pressure is difficult to alleviate. If the key support level is breached, the three major meme coins may face a new round of decline. Investors should closely monitor pattern breakdowns and moving average crossovers, and carefully set stop-loss orders to respond to market fluctuations.
